Questions & Answers
Q: What are the main functions of plant stems?
Plant stems support the plant, transport water and nutrients, and provide a structure for growth, including leaves and flowers. They also store nutrients and play a role in photosynthesis.
Q: How do herbaceous stems differ from woody stems?
Herbaceous stems, like those of dandelions, are not thick and do not add much girth over time. In contrast, woody stems, as seen in cypresses, grow thicker each year, forming age rings.
Q: What is the role of the epidermis and cortex in a plant stem?
The epidermis, akin to skin, has a protective cuticle to prevent water loss and infections. The cortex transports materials and stores carbohydrates in the stem.
Q: How do trichomes contribute to plant protection?
Trichomes are hair-like structures on the stem that deter herbivores, reduce evaporation, reflect sunlight, and may contain toxins for defense, such as in stinging nettles.
